How to Change a Google Calendar Invite

Changing a Google Calendar invite is a relatively straightforward process. Here are the steps to follow:

To change an invite, you first need to open Google Calendar and navigate to the event you wish to modify. You can do this by clicking on the event in your calendar view. Once you’ve opened the event, you can make the necessary changes. This could involve changing the event’s time, date, location, or description. After making the changes, click on the “Save” button to update the event.

Notifying Guests of Changes

When you update an event, Google Calendar gives you the option to notify the guests about the changes. This is a crucial step, as it ensures that all invitees are aware of the updates. To notify guests, check the box that says “Notify guests” before saving the changes. Guests will then receive an email update with the new event details.

Common Issues and Solutions

Despite the simplicity of changing a Google Calendar invite, you might encounter some issues. Here are some common problems and their solutions:

Guests Not Receiving Notifications

If guests are not receiving notifications about event changes, check that you have selected the “Notify guests” option when saving the changes. Also, ensure that the guests’ email addresses are correct and that they do not have any email filters that might be blocking the notifications.

Unable to Edit an Event

If you’re unable to edit an event, check that you have the necessary permissions. Only the event creator or editors can make changes to an event. If you’re a guest, you will not be able to edit the event, but you can suggest changes to the event creator.

How do I add or remove attendees from a Google Calendar invitation?

To add or remove attendees from a Google Calendar invitation, users can follow a few simple steps. First, they need to open the event in Google Calendar and click on the “Edit event” button. Next, they can click on the “Add guests” button to add new attendees or click on the “X” button next to an attendee’s name to remove them. Users can also use the “Add from directory” option to add attendees from their organization’s directory or use the “Add from contacts” option to add attendees from their personal contacts.

When adding or removing attendees, users can also choose to send updates to the affected attendees. Google Calendar provides an option to send a notification to the new attendees or to the attendees who have been removed. This ensures that everyone is informed of the changes and can update their own calendars accordingly. Additionally, users can also use the “Optional” and “Required” labels to indicate the level of attendance required for each attendee, providing greater clarity and flexibility when managing event invitations.
